Share via


ISecurityProperty::GetOriginalCreatorSID-Methode (comsvcs.h)

In MTS 2.0 ruft diese Methode den Sicherheitsbezeichner des Basisprozesses ab, der die Aktivität initiiert hat, in der das aktuelle Objekt ausgeführt wird. Verwenden Sie diese Methode nicht in COM+.

Syntax

HRESULT GetOriginalCreatorSID(
  [out] PSID *pSID
);

Parameter

[out] pSID

Ein Verweis auf die Sicherheits-ID des Basisprozesses, der die Aktivität initiiert hat, in der das aktuelle Objekt ausgeführt wird.

Rückgabewert

Diese Methode kann die Standardrückgabewerte E_INVALIDARG, E_OUTOFMEMORY, E_UNEXPECTED und E_FAIL sowie die folgenden Werte zurückgeben.

Rückgabecode BESCHREIBUNG
S_OK
Die Sicherheits-ID des ursprünglich erstellten wird im Parameter pSid zurückgegeben.
CONTEXT_E_NOCONTEXT
Dem aktuellen Objekt ist kein Kontext zugeordnet, da entweder die Komponente nicht in eine Anwendung importiert wurde oder das Objekt nicht mit einer der CREATEInstance-Methoden von COM+ erstellt wurde.

Anforderungen

Anforderung Wert
Unterstützte Mindestversion (Client) Windows 2000 Professional [nur Desktop-Apps]
Unterstützte Mindestversion (Server) Windows 2000 Server [nur Desktop-Apps]
Zielplattform Windows
Kopfzeile comsvcs.h

Weitere Informationen

IObjectContext

ISecurityProperty